IBS (INDUSTRIALISED BUILDING SYSTEM) VERSUS CONVENTIONAL BUILDING METHOD

IBS METHOD FEATURE CONVENTIONAL METHODTIME TAKEN AROUND HALF OF

YEAR OR LESSTIME USED FOR COMPLETION

OF PROJECTUSUALLY TAKING 1-2 YEARS TO COMPLETE,DEPENDING TO THE

SCALE OF THE PROJECTCHEAP BECAUSE THE

COMPONENT ARE PRODUCED IN FACTORY THUS REDUCE THE

WASTAGE OF COST FOR FORMWORK

COSTING A LARGE AMOUNT NEEDED FOR CONSTRUCTION USES SUCH AS

COST FOR MAKING FORMWORK etc.

ALL WORK IS DONE BY USING MACHINE AND ONLY NEED FEW WORKER THAT PROFESSIONAL

IN IBS SYSTEM

REDUCE LABOUR WORKER THIS METHOD NEED MANY LABOUR WORKER DUE TO ALL WORK ARE DONE MANUALLY

THE USE IBS WILL DECREASE THE USING OF TIMBER ON CONSTRUCTION PROJECT

ENVIRONMENTAL FRIENDLY LESS-ENVIRONMENTAL FRIENDLY DUE TO HIGH

AMOUNT OF TIMBER USED ON CONSTRUCTION

AN IBS COMPONENT HAVE HIGHER QUALITY AND BETTER

FINISHES DUE TO CAREFUL SELECTION OF MATERIALS AND

USE OF ADVANCE TECHNOLOGY

QUALITY AND FINISHES OF PROJECT

GOOD QUALITY BUT THE RATE OF FINISHES WOULD AFFECTED

WITH THE WEATHER CONDITION

LARGE WORKING AREA NEEDED,FOR TRANSFER AND

STORAGE OF IBS COMPONENT

SIZE OF THE WORKING AREA OPTIMUM WORKING AREA NEEDED DUE TO

CONSTRUCTION DONE PHASE BY PHASE

LEAKAGE IS OFTEN THE MAJOR PROBLEM IN BUILDING

CONSTRUCTED USING IBS.THIS PROBLEM IS OBVIOUS IN

MALAYSIA WHERE RAINING RAPIDLY OCCUR THROUGHT

OUT YEAR

PROBLEMS OF JOINTS THIS METHOD DOES NOT USE JOINTING WHERE THE

STRUCTURE BUILD MANUALLY AND LESS LEAKING PROBLEM

OCCUR
